Output 5badd418ad99659efb40851539d344e891ab6839ae5fdf62eda4167f6c89d614:0

value
408362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ab189ef53e523fcb1ba23e740dcb975fbd4a82cb OP_EQUAL
address
3HHgy3DEWj5CjJ6BWsrUHgCSaQKc4jzQNR
transaction
5badd418ad99659efb40851539d344e891ab6839ae5fdf62eda4167f6c89d614
spent
true